We propose a realistic scheme for measuring the micromaser linewidth bymonitoring the phase diffusion dynamics of the cavity field. Our strategyconsists in exciting an initial coherent state with the same photon numberdistribution as the micromaser steady-state field, singling out a purelydiffusive process in the system dynamics. After the injection of acounter-field, measurements of the population statistics of a probe atom allowus to derive the micromaser linewidth. Our proposal aims at solving a classicand relevant decoherence problem in cavity quantum electrodynamics, allowing toestablish experimentally the distinctive features appearing in the micromaserspectrum due to the discreteness of the electromagnetic field.
